Key Features of the Volkswagen 7 Seater SUV
When considering a vehicle for a large family, certain features become paramount. The Volkswagen 7 seater SUV offers a range of attributes that make it a compelling choice:
- Spacious Interior: With three rows of seating, this SUV can comfortably seat up to seven passengers. The interior is designed to maximize space, ensuring that even the third row provides adequate legroom.
- Advanced Safety Features: Safety is a top priority for families, and Volkswagen delivers with a suite of safety technologies, including adaptive cruise control, lane-keeping assist, and automated emergency braking.
- Infotainment and Connectivity: Equipped with a state-of-the-art infotainment system, the SUV offers seamless connectivity through Apple CarPlay, Android Auto, and a premium sound system, keeping passengers entertained on long journeys.
- Fuel Efficiency: Despite its size, the Volkswagen 7 seater SUV is engineered for efficiency, offering impressive fuel economy that helps reduce the overall cost of ownership.
Comparison with Other SUVs
To provide a comprehensive understanding of where the Volkswagen 7 seater SUV stands, it’s crucial to compare it with other popular models in the market. Below is a comparison table highlighting key aspects of several leading SUVs for large families:
Model | Seating Capacity | Fuel Economy (MPG) | Safety Features | Starting Price (USD) |
---|---|---|---|---|
Volkswagen 7 Seater SUV | 7 | 20/27 | Adaptive Cruise Control, Lane-Keeping Assist | $35,000 |
Ford Explorer | 7 | 21/28 | Blind Spot Monitoring, Rear Cross Traffic Alert | $36,000 |
Chevrolet Traverse | 8 | 18/27 | Forward Collision Alert, Lane Change Alert | $34,000 |
Honda Pilot | 8 | 20/27 | Collision Mitigation Braking System, Road Departure Mitigation | $37,000 |
